Επίπεδο 4.5 του βιβλίου ασκήσεων Rust
Λάβετε ένα διάνυσμα όλων των αριθμών από 1
έως 1000, των οποίων το άθροισμα των ψηφίων
διαιρείται με το 3 ή με το 9.
Δίνεται ένας ακέραιος αριθμός:
let num: i16 = 12;
Γράψτε ένα πρόγραμμα που θα γεμίσει ένα διάνυσμα με τους διαιρέτες αυτού του αριθμού.
Γράψτε ένα πρόγραμμα που θα δημιουργήσει την ακόλουθη συμβολοσειρά:
"xxxxx yyyyy zzzzz"
Δίνονται τιμές σε pixels, που περιέχουν ακέραιους αριθμούς:
let size1: &str = "12px";
let size2: &str = "15px";
Προσθέστε αυτές τις τιμές έτσι, ώστε το αποτέλεσμα να είναι επίσης σε pixels:
"28px"
Δίνεται διάνυσμα:
[1, 2, 3]
Δημιουργήστε ένα νέο διάνυσμα έτσι ώστε σε αυτό κάθε στοιχείο του πρώτου διανύσματος να επαναλαμβάνεται δύο φορές:
[1, 1, 2, 2, 3, 3]
Δίνεται διάνυσμα:
[1, 2, 3, 4, 5]
Δημιουργήστε ένα νέο διάνυσμα έτσι ώστε
στο νέο διάνυσμα να υπάρχουν όλα τα στοιχεία
του πρώτου διανύσματος, εκτός από τα
N πρώτα στοιχεία.